I am using Windows XP Professional. When I lock my system, the network is disabled automatically. And when I unlock the system, the network connection is restored automatically.

Because of this disabling of network connection, I tend to lose the conncetion to Mainframes Server.

So every time if I lock the system, I need to reconnect to the Mainframes.

What may be the cause for this?

I'd suggest you check with your network support people and ask if this is as planned or if it is an error.

Most environments do not automatically drop the network connection when the workstation is locked.
